ICYMI: Wounded Veterans Bike Ride to Pass Through Melrose

The organizers are expecting 7,000 motorcycle riders in honor of wounded veterans.

Editor's Note: Here's a reminder of the Wounded Veterans Bike Ride scheduled to pass through Melrose Saturday.

MELROSE, MA—If you see a wave of motorcycle riders passing through Melrose Saturday, don't fear.

According to the City of Melrose Website, The Wounded Vet Bike Run motorcycle ride is scheduled to pass through Melrose on May 14. The riders are expecting to enter Melrose on Washington St. at about 12:45, and will travel north to the Fellsway East and the Lynn Fells Parkway before turning left on to Main St. towards Wakefield.

The organizers are expecting 7,000 motorcycles riding in honor of wounded veterans. The event began in 2011, inspired by Cpl. Vincent Mannion Brodeur, who received a bronze star and purple heart while serving in Iraq in 2007.
